Edo PDP holds National Delegates Election in 17 LGAs as C’ttee Chair commends conduct of poll

The Deputy Governor of Delta State and Chairman of the Edo State National Delegate Electoral Committee, Sir Monday Onyeme, has commended the conduct of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) National delegates election which held across the State's 17 local councils, noting that the process was very peaceful, transparent and credible.

The Chairman and other members of the electoral Committee went round some venues of the election, including Eghosa Anglican Grammar School in Egor Local Government Area and Urokpota Hall in Oredo Local Government Area to monitor the process and interact with the delegates, INEC officials and electoral officers, among other stakeholders.

Onyeme who briefed journalists after the monitoring at the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) Secretariat along Airport Road, Benin City, said he was impressed and satisfied with the conduct of the exercise which he described as very credible, free and fair.

At Eghosa Anglican Grammar School in Egor, Chief Odion Olaye won the National delegate election with 30 votes, defeating other candidates while in Ikpoba-Okha, Solomon Idehen won with 28 votes beating other candidates.

In Oredo Local Government Area, Chief Osaro Idah emerged winner in a very peaceful and credible national delegate election.
